Summary
Join Factor Eleven as a Senior Data Engineer to design, build, and maintain scalable data pipelines and platforms for our SaaS digital advertising products. Collaborate with Product Managers and Engineers to ensure data system performance and alignment with business goals. Mentor fellow data engineers, lead technical discussions, and contribute to critical projects. Leverage your expertise in building modern data stacks, particularly Lakehouse architecture and cloud-based platforms. This role requires strong AWS, Python, and SQL skills, along with experience in tools like dbt, Apache Spark, and Kafka/Kinesis. You will consistently deliver high-impact data solutions and promote best practices for data engineering.
